Model number: KD55X75WLU.
2023 model.
Dimensions and Weight
- Screen size: 55 inches.
- Size of TV H72.1, W124.3, D7.1cm.
- Size of TV with stand: H78.9, W124.3, D33.4cm.
- Width of TV stand 60cm.
- Weight of TV without stand 15.3kg (unpackaged).
- Weight of TV with stand 15.6kg.
- Suitable for wall mounting 300 x 300 bracket.
- Length of cable: 1.5m.
- Packaged size H82.8, W134.8, D16cm.
- Packaged weight 21kg.
Screen Technology
- LED TV Screen.
- 4K Ultra HD display resolution.
- HDR.
- Dolby Vision.
- HDR10.
- HLG.
- Motion rate 60Hz.
- Viewing angle 178/178 degrees.
- Resolution 3840 x 2160 pixels.
Sound Technology
- Dolby Atmos sound system.
- 20 watt RMS power output.
Connectivity
- 2 USB ports and 4 HDMI sockets.
- AV socket.
- Optical connection.
- Built in Wi-Fi.
- Ethernet connection.
- Bluetooth.
Smart TV features
- Voice control - works with Amazon Alexa, built in Google assistant, works with Siri.
- Google TV operating system.
- Compatible with the following smart apps: Now TV, Disney+, Netflix, BBC iPlayer, iTVX, My5, All 4, Amazon Prime, YouTube.
- Internet browser.
Additional features
- Features USB recording and video playback.
- Freeview HD and Freesat HD digital tuner.
- Freeview HD (UK).
- X1 4K HDR processor processor.
- CI plus slot.
- Sleep timer.
- Parental controls.
- Aerial not required.
Energy efficiency information:
- Energy efficiency class: G.
- Energy consumption per 1000h: 91kWh.
- Energy consumption in high dynamic mode per 1000h: 123kWh.
- Standby power consumption 0.5 watt.
In the box
- TV.
- Remote control (requires 4 x AAA batteries, included).
- Power cable.
- TV stand.
- Screws.
- Also in the box: Operating Instructions, Quick Setup Guide.
General information:
- Manufacturer's 1 year guarantee.
- EAN: 4548736150287.

Hi Taylor,
You can choose what displays on your KD55X75WLU screen when you're not watching anything.
Choose your screensaver:
From the Google TV home screen, select Settings and then System and then Ambient mode.
Choose what you want to show:
Google Photos: Choose photos or albums saved in your Google Photos account.
Art gallery: Choose featured photos, fine art and more.
Experimental: Try out new sources and content.
